How can companies strike a balance between maintaining data security and fostering collaboration among departments when it comes to sharing sensitive customer information?
Companies can strike a balance between data security and collaboration by implementing strict access controls and encryption protocols to protect sensitive customer information. They can also provide training to employees on data security best practices and the importance of confidentiality. Additionally, companies can utilize secure collaboration tools that allow for sharing information within departments while still maintaining data security measures. Regular audits and monitoring of data access can also help ensure that sensitive information is only shared on a need-to-know basis.
